The Breast Cancer Score in 21061, Glen Burnie, Maryland is 45 out of 100 when comparing 34,000 ZIP Codes in the United States.
79.18 percent of the population in 21061 drive to work alone. 3.37 percent of the people take some form of public transportation like the bus or the train to work. Approximately 63.13 percent of the residents get to work in less than 30 minutes. 10.19 percent of the residents in 21061 get to work in more than 60 minutes. The average household size is approximately 2.38 members with about 2.00 cars available per household.
An estimate of 93.36 percent of the residents in 21061 has some form of health insurance. 35.14 percent of the residents have some type of public health insurance like Medicare, Medicaid, Veterans Affairs (VA), or TRICARE. About 71.70 percent of the residents have private health insurance, either through their employer or direct purchase.
A resident in 21061 would have to travel an average of 1.75 miles to reach the nearest hospital with an emergency room, University Of Md Baltimore Washington Medical Center . In a 20-mile radius, there are 0 healthcare providers accessible to residents in 21061, Glen Burnie, Maryland.

As of , an estimate of 55,960 residents live in 21061 with a median age of 36.1 years. 22.69 percent of the population is under the age of 18, and 13.21 percent of the population is at least 65 years of age. 39.44 percent of the residents in 21061 is currently married, and 22.61 percent of the population has never been married.
The monthly median household income in 21061 is $7,331.08. The monthly median housing costs for residents in 21061 is approximately $1,531. The median household spends about 20.88 percent of their income on housing.
